Output 0cd8c26a56bb701e3662eddb040f743c9549fc94c3162f781fbb391880900c7e:3

value
3851843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fe1f3d237952fb6ae284747c1f0e2d723e40930 OP_EQUAL
address
37WoB5XdT8T5mAotfoBXFjXoXnRbtepGXw
transaction
0cd8c26a56bb701e3662eddb040f743c9549fc94c3162f781fbb391880900c7e
confirmations
325112
spent
true